    Re: New Toshiba colour series eBridge-X (es4540c and es6550c Series)

    Quote Originally Posted by sdrawkcab View Post
    The eb3 drivers work fine on the ebx unless you need specific ebx driver features.

    The latest version ebx driver is an improvement on the first version, but I agree, some work still needed.
    The EB3 Drivers are fine unless you want to use Department Codes in which case you need to use the EBX drivers.
    However ONLY use Client CD 2.01 DO NOT USE 1.0 or 1.2 as these drivers are flawed.
    So far we have installed many X-Mash machines and 1 X-BP with an X-BP-Pro to go in this week.
    Also - Beware the Plugins on the Universal Driver. the driver works much better if you do not install the plugins.

    Just noticed there is a new release (v2.12) have not tested it yet but will do.
    It is also worth noting that with all Toshiba drivers you can not have two different versions of the same driver on a machine. If you plan to upgrade a driver the old one must be fully removed before the new one is installed.
